Download analisis-bilib

Document related concepts
no text concepts found
Transcript
Análisis de aplicación: TightVNC
Este documento ha sido elaborado por el Centro de Apoyo Tecnológico a Emprendedores ­ bilib, www.bilib.es
Copyright © 2011, Junta de Comunidades de Castilla­La Mancha. Este documento se distribuye bajo los términos de la licencia Creative Commons by­sa. http://creativecommons.org/licenses/by­sa/2.5/es/
Índice de contenido
DATOS TÉCNICOS ........................................................................................................................
2
FUNCIONALIDAD ........................................................................................................................
3
USABILIDAD .................................................................................................................................
5
PORTABILIDAD / ADAPTABILIDAD ........................................................................................
6
RENDIMIENTO ..............................................................................................................................
7
DOCUMENTACIÓN ......................................................................................................................
8
COMUNIDAD .................................................................................................................................
9
REFERENCIAS .............................................................................................................................
10
Página 1 de 10
DATOS TÉCNICOS
Nombre: TightVNC
Versión: 2.5
Licencia: GPL v2
Plataforma: Todas
Idioma: Inglés Web oficial: http://www.tightvnc.com/
Manual: http://www.tightvnc.com/docs.php
Descripción básica: TightVNC es un software que permite controlar otros equipos de forma remota mediante el protocolo VNC. Está disponible para todas las plataformas, puesto que está implementado en Java y tan sólo necesita de la máquina virtual de Java para ejecutarse.
Página 2 de 10
FUNCIONALIDAD
• Visualización y manejo de escritorios remotos
Ésta es la funcionalidad principal de la aplicación. TightVNC permite visualizar el escritorio de otra máquina de forma remota desde nuestro propio equipo, además de tomar el control del mismo si así lo deseamos. De esta forma, esta funcionalidad facilita la asistencia técnica a distancia, entre otros aspectos.
•
Grabación de la monitorización en vídeo
Se permite la posibilidad de grabar en vídeo la captura de imágenes que se realiza del escritorio remoto durante el período de tiempo que se mantiene la monitorización.
No caben destacar más funcionalidades de la aplicación, puesto que el punto fuerte de ésta es el hecho de ser multiplataforma. Aun así, es de importancia conocer que se permite una amplia configuración de la conexión a realizar, estableciendo parámetros como el nivel de compresión de la imagen, la calidad de la misma, el modo de sólo visión, etc.
Página 3 de 10
Fallos y/o carencias importantes
Cuando la visualización del escritorio remoto y las acciones asociadas al control remoto del mismo requieren de una capacidad de manejo de gráficos ciertamente compleja, el programa puede experimentar una serie de retardos en la visualización correcta de la pantalla. Esto puede ser debido a la carga del sistema o de la red.
Además de todo esto, la aplicación podría incorporar varias funcionalidades más, como la conexión simultánea y el rastreo de máquinas disponibles en la red. Aun así, TightVNC cumple con el objetivo principal de monitorización y manejo de un escritorio remoto.
Página 4 de 10
USABILIDAD
Diseño de la interfaz
El diseño de la interfaz es sencillo, todo lo que puede pedirse para una aplicación de estas características. Puesto que el principal objetivo de TightVNC es la visualización y el manejo de un escritorio remoto, la mayor parte del tiempo que empleemos en el uso del programa se efectuará manejando las interfaces del equipo remoto.
La herramienta dispone de una ventana para la configuración de las preferencias de la conexión. Esta ventana es de diseño sencillo y está estructuradas de manera que la configuración resulte lo más intuitiva posible para el usuario. Los parámetros a especificar son de fácil comprensión y evita que el usuario caiga en complicaciones.
Durante la conexión, se despliega una barra con botones en la parte superior que permite acceder a las acciones disponibles durante la monitorización, tales como zoom, envío de Ctrl+Alt+Del o la funcionalidad de grabación de vídeo. De esta forma, el acceso a las opciones del programa es rápido y sencillo.
Facilidad de uso
Puesto que es posible realizar una conexión con un equipo remoto tan sólo especificando la dirección IP del equipo, la facilidad de uso del programa es máxima. Además, el resto de opciones que aparecen en las ventanas de configuración permiten que se establezcan de forma rápida las preferencias para la conexión a realizar.
Accesibilidad
Esta herramienta no dispone de herramientas de accesibilidad propias, siendo necesario recurrir a las incorporadas por el sistema operativo.
Página 5 de 10
PORTABILIDAD / ADAPTABILIDAD
Plataformas disponibles
TightVNC se encuentra disponible como aplicación instalable para sistemas GNU/Linux y Windows. Además, la herramienta para visión de escritorios remotos dispone de una versión en Java, con lo que, siempre y cuando esté instalada la máquina virtual de Java, podrá ejecutarse en cualquier plataforma.
Plugins
Esta aplicación no dispone de plugins ni add­ons.
Página 6 de 10
RENDIMIENTO
Equipo de pruebas
(1)
Sistema operativo: Ubuntu 11.10 Oneiric Ocelot
Procesador: AMD Opteron 244
Memoria RAM: 1 GB
Tarjeta Gráfica: nVidia Corporation NV18GL
(2)
Sistema operativo: Windows Vista
Procesador: Intel Core 2 Duo T6500
Memoria RAM: 4 GB
Tarjeta Gráfica: nVidia GeForce G 105M
Consumo de memoria
El consumo de memoria de la aplicación TightVNC, durante la visualización y el manejo de un escritorio remoto, ha sido el siguiente:
–
–
En torno a los 37.3 MB en Ubuntu, habiendo sido monitorizado con el monitor del sistema.
En torno a los 60 MB en Windows, habiendo sido monitorizado con el monitor del sistema.
El proceso monitorizado fue el proceso de Java, puesto que el visor de escritorios remotos de la aplicación está implementado en Java.
Velocidad de ejecución
La velocidad de ejecución y de uso es, en general, fluido. En la mayoría de los casos, la fluidez dependerá de las características y el estado de la red, al acceder a un equipo remoto a través de la red misma.
Página 7 de 10
DOCUMENTACIÓN
En la web de TightVNC [1] se puede encontrar una amplia y clara documentación [2] acerca del uso de la aplicación, disponible únicamente en inglés. La mayor parte de la información disponible es sobre el uso y configuración de la herramienta.
No existe documentación para desarrolladores, puesto que la forma principal de contribución al proyecto es a través de la sugerencia de funcionalidades [3] y el reporte de bugs encontrados en la aplicación [4].
Para resolver dudas acerca del producto, se dispone de una sección de preguntas frecuentes (FAQ) [5] y una serie de listas de correo [6].
Página 8 de 10
COMUNIDAD
Número de usuarios
Es difícil hacer una estimación del número de descargas de TightVNC, ya que se descarga normalmente del apartado correspondiente en la web oficial [7] y no existe una forma de obtener las estadísticas de descarga de la aplicación, pudiendo también ser descarga desde los repositorios de algunas distribuciones, como Ubuntu. Aunque no se puede obtener un dato concreto, se puede deducir con esto que la aplicación cuenta con una gran difusión y aceptación entre los usuarios.
Foros y portales de ayuda
No se dispone de foros ni portales de ayuda específicos para la atención a usuarios, pero es posible resolver dudas mediante la consulta apartado de FAQ y recibir asistencia mediante el uso de las listas de correo disponibles.
Contribuciones
Se puede colaborar con el proyecto reportando bugs y sugiriendo funcionalidades o características. Además, existe una lista de correo para desarrolladores, a la que puede suscribirse cualquier usuario interesado y colaborar.
Frecuencia de versiones
La primera versión de TightVNC de la que se tiene constancia es la versión 2.0, de la cual no se ha podido concretar la fecha de publicación, aunque el proyecto comenzó en el año 2001. Desde dicha versión, se han ido liberando numerosas versiones con las correspondientes correcciones y mejoras, hasta llegar a la 2.5.1, versión estable actual de la aplicación.
Página 9 de 10
REFERENCIAS
[1] ­ http://www.tightvnc.com/
[2] ­ http://www.tightvnc.com/docs.php
[3] ­ http://www.tightvnc.com/rfe.php
[4] ­ http://www.tightvnc.com/bugs.php
[5] ­ http://www.tightvnc.com/faq.php
[6] ­ http://www.tightvnc.com/lists.php
[7] ­ http://www.tightvnc.com/download.php
Página 10 de 10